China's Impact on Global Currency Dynamics
This chapter explores the implications of China's role in the medical supply chain amid U.S.-China trade tensions, while assessing the risks to the U.S. dollar's status as a reserve currency. It discusses the potential for a financial crisis and the rise of alternative currencies like the euro, highlighting Europe's opportunity for enhanced coordination in response to global challenges.
